David Kool - Professional Career

Professional Career

Kool was invited to the 2010 Portsmouth Invitational, an event that invites 64 of the best senior college players to participate in a four-day tournament.

After the completion of his career at WMU, Kool returned to coach the WMU men's basketball team as an undergraduate assistant.

Starting in the 2011-12 season, Kool serves as an Assistant coach for the team under Head coach Steve Hawkins.
